Experimental Study On The Properties And Mechanism Of Solidified Saline Soil In Inshore With SH Agent And Lime For Construction Of Road Embankment

There is a lot of saline soil in the west land of Bohai gulf, in usually saline soil should be solidified before using for engineering construction. Take the road embankment of highway for an example, the solidified saline soil with lime is prone to absorb water and lose some strength. A great quantity of previous research results in laboratory have demonstrated that mixing the SH agent into solidified soil with lime can effectively increase the strength and obviously improve the water stabilization. The in-situ compaction test was carried out in the important place of coastal highway located in Fengnan country of Hebei province (the percentage of easily dissolved saline is 3.87),which principally studied the suitability of applying previous research results in laboratory to the practice; and the experiments in laboratory were tested with same saline soil and same solidifying materials during the same period, in which the mechanism of SH agent was explored; meanwhile the influencing factors to the effect of solidified soil with SH agent and lime were analyzed in this thesis. Main research contents and results are as follows:(1)Took the typical section of coastal highway located in Fengnan country of Hebei province as experimental road, on which the in-situ compaction test of solidified soil with lime and SH agent + lime were carried out. When the curing periods of experimental road embankment were one, two, three and four weeks, such tests as the compression strength of the big piece of soil models, shear strength, compression and permeability were done in laboratory, and all experimental samples came from the site of experimental road. It has been indicated that the water stability of solidified soil is improved, the strength and distorted resistance is increased by mixing SH agent into the solidified soil with lime.(2)After curing period of six weeks of the experimental road, the Degree of compaction, California Bearing Ratio, rebound modulus, deflection value of compacted soil were inspected in site. It has demonstrated that these parameters of solidified soil with SH agent that have met the requirements of road embankment of highway, it is better than those with lime only.(3)The experiments in laboratory of solidified soil with lime and SH agent +lime were done with same saline soil and same solidifying material during the same period of the test in site, which included California Bearing Ratio test, unconfined compression strength test, pull strength test, triaxial compression test, compression test and permeability test. It has revealed that SH agent can improve the strength of solidified soil and decrease the abilities of permeated and distorted, which is identical with the results of compaction test in site.(4)In order to research the solidifying mechanism of SH agent, the microstructure pictures of solidified soil with lime and SH agent + lime were taken by using SEM, and Leica QWin5000 was used to treat these pictures. It has been certified that SH agent encloses soil particles and makes the connection like fishing net between particles and in void, which increases the strength and improves the precluding water.(5)Based on the previous experiments in laboratory, the compaction test in site and the experiments in the same period of compaction test, the influencing factors of the effect of solidified soil with SH agent+lime have been analyzed.
